Transaction f62df5a478039024a62e2c5380a873e7a35bc5a814933b150ed42d60ff60faa5

1 Input
2 Outputs
  • f62df5a478039024a62e2c5380a873e7a35bc5a814933b150ed42d60ff60faa5:0
  • value  14254817
    address  33H3F7yQyEeQa5DVhH2CN3gbiLEiziY9ka
  • f62df5a478039024a62e2c5380a873e7a35bc5a814933b150ed42d60ff60faa5:1
  • value  342904802
    address  33KRAL92jv1nvjcXDvSUcKEjVnjRh84JQH